Is 109 116 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 109 116 is about 330.327.

Thus, the square root of 109 116 is not an integer, and therefore 109 116 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 109 116?

The square of a number (here 109 116) is the result of the product of this number (109 116) by itself (i.e., 109 116 × 109 116); the square of 109 116 is sometimes called "raising 109 116 to the power 2", or "109 116 squared".

The square of 109 116 is 11 906 301 456 because 109 116 × 109 116 = 109 1162 = 11 906 301 456.

As a consequence, 109 116 is the square root of 11 906 301 456.
